Nothing Funny Ever Happens to Me (Carol Leigh aka Scarlot Harlot)

This was an old appearance on The TWIT show (Tucson Western International Television) circa 1985, actually in another persona altogether…about my experience trying to do stand up comedy. Sorry it’s not funny 🙁

Related Videos

Free Whores by Scarlot Harlot (6 min.)
Annie Sprinkle’s Herstory of Porn
Stop Silencing Us- Sex Workers Protest Anti Trafficking Strategies 2014
Scarlot Harlot on TV Magazine Show (7 min.)

Leave a Reply

Your email address will not be published. Required fields are marked *